How to Apply for a Saudi Company Visa for Indian Citizens – An entire Guidebook
Saudi Arabia is often a thriving hub of business chances, attracting specialists and business people from across the globe. For Indian businesspersons seeking to examine trade, partnerships, or investments inside the Kingdom, acquiring a Saudi company visa for Indians is important. This visa lets people to enter the region for professional purposes